Geotechnical engineering is a branch of civil engineering; nevertheless, it entails using clinical techniques and principles to accumulate and analyze the physical buildings of the ground. Geotechnical designers are included in all stages of the layout of structures, from concept to construction. Their job is essential in the design and preparation process as they assess the honesty of dirt, clay, silt, sand, and rock, prior to construction starting.

Geotechnical designers analyse dirt, rock, groundwater, and various other subsurface conditions to review their suitability for construction. This know-how allows them to forecast exactly how these materials will certainly react to frameworks like structures, roads, dams, and bridges, assisting make sure secure and stable foundations. Every building or facilities job relies upon a foundation that is risk-free and stable.
Geotechnical design assists prevent different environmental dangers that might jeopardize both people and the atmosphere. Via soil analysis, engineers can identify prospective problems like landslides, soil liquefaction, and disintegration risks.

Proper geotechnical investigation sites can considerably lower construction costs by recognizing prospective problems prior to building and construction begins. Recognizing the subsurface conditions aids in choosing the most effective structure kind and various other architectural elements, therefore staying clear of pricey redesigns and repair work.

Slope stability and Planet retention: In uneven or sloped terrain, preserving slope stability is important to stop landslides, erosion, and dirt movement. Geotechnical engineers examine the security of inclines and style earth retention systems such as maintaining my response walls or slope stabilization steps to mitigate risks and guarantee safety.
